After spending his last two seasons as a player at MLS club LAFC, the Italy legend brought the curtain down on his illustrious career last month. But even after retirement, he is all set to remain associated with The Black and Golds as he has been appointed as the club's Player Development Coach.

After announcing their association with the former defender, LAFC co-president and general manager, John Thorrington told the club's official website, "We were thankful to have Giorgio play the final 18 months of his playing career with LAFC. During that time he proved what an asset he is for LAFC in a number of ways, and we are excited to add a truly brilliant football mind, incredible leader and an even better person to our staff for the upcoming season."

The 39-year-old former Juventus star appeared in 45 matches across all competitions for LAFC in the two seasons he spent at the club and scored one goal. He won the 2022 Supporters' Shield and 2022 MLS Cup titles with the club and finished runners-up in the 2023 CONCACAF Champions League.
